Obviously, one wouldn't wear a tiny bikini with grandparents, little cousins, or nieces/nephews around. But hey, maybe that's your vibe. However, if you're on the hunt for something cute and trendy to wear to the beach or pool while on vacation with your family, this list is perfect for you.
There are so many modest swimsuits on the market that swallow you up in fabric and are just really unflattering. Away with those outdated designs that don't do you any favors! You should look good and feel good on your vacation.
We've gathered up some of the best swimwear options for when you're looking for something family-friendly that aren't super revealing but still has a chic and sexy vibe. Read on for cool one piece suits, tankinis, or swim dresses that are family-vacay-approved.
This top seller on Amazon is exactly what you need if you want to be a bit more modest yet still fashionable with your swimwear choices. It's a one piece with a midriff cut out and back tie knot that comes in a bunch of different colors and patterns to choose from.
This green gingham is a great summer print, and the ruffle straps and tie-up keyhole back make this full coverage Target suit a strong contender. The removable cups and underwire provide great support that really brings it home.
This suit is such a chic option with the one shoulder design, side cutout, and a stunning side tie. It's perfect for pool-side lounging, and it's easy to dress up with jewelry and other accessories for a fancier, more put-together look.
With the ruching, twist front, and sweetheart neckline, this bright red one piece swimsuit will definitely make you a standout this summer. It's perfect for a Fourth of July pool party!
Sometimes the traditional swimsuits aren't for everyone. This swim dress uses a side tie knot at the hem of the skirt to make it seem like you're wearing a cute bottom coverup, so you can still look trendy while feeling covered.
If you're looking for a family-friendly two piece set, then search no further. This hipster style tankini from Cupshe has a flounce hem top and lace-up back to add some flare. Plus, it comes with adjustable straps!
This swimsuit is an eyecatcher with its pretty pink floral pattern and side cutout with a nice tie-up detail. It may be strapless, but it still has great coverage.
Simple in the front with a strappy back, this full coverage Aerie suit has a classy, yet flirty look to keep it stylish on the family beach trip.
Color blocking is always a good move, so consider this one piece bathing suit with a three-sectioned color block pattern and a cute bow at the waist for your next vacation.
Madewell has a great variety of sustainable swimsuits just like this tropical print tie-back one piece made with recycled material.
Here's another two piece option for girlies who still want to show off a little bit of skin. A bandeau top and matching high-waisted bottoms are the best combo for a more modest bikini style.
